Basic Information

Product Name 3,4-Dichloro-2-Naphthalenamine
CAS No. 57346-59-5
Molecular Formula C₁₀H₇Cl₂N
Molecular Weight 212.08 g/mol
Synonyms 2-Amino-3,4-dichloronaphthalene; 3,4-Dichloro-2-naphthylamine; 3,4-Dichloronaphthalen-2-amine; 2-Naphthalenamine, 3,4-dichloro-; 3,4-Dichloro-2-aminonaphthalene; 3,4-Dichloro-β-naphthylamine

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from heat, sparks, and open flame. Due to its light-sensitive nature, containers should be amber-colored or stored in dark conditions.
